Order all 16 Kemtec AP Chemistry Kits at once.

Both series kits include a balance. And all kits are designed to exceed 2013 AP Next Generation National Standards.

The Basic AP Chemistry Series Kit includes:

  • Statistics: Precision & Accuracy (no glassware S07328)
  • Spectrophotometric Analysis of Copper: Beer's Law (S07330)
  • Synthesis and Gravimetric Analysis of Cobalt Oxalate Hydrate (S07331)
  • Acid-Base Titrations: An Inquiry Investigation (S07332)
  • Separating Substances by Absorption Chromatography (S07333)
  • Stoichiometry: Reactions with Copper Compounds (S07334)
  • Stoichiometry: Mole Ratio of an Unknown (S07335)
  • Determining Molar Mass by Colligative Properties (S07336)
  • Determining Molar Mass Using the Ideal Gas Equation (S07337)
  • Reaction Rate and Order (S07338)
  • Determining Molar Enthalpy Using Hess's Law (S07339)
  • Le Chatelier's Principle Featuring Ag+ reaction! (S07340)
  • Identifying Weak Acids by pKa (S07341)
  • Preparing Buffer Solutions and Determining Their Properties (S07342)
  • Determining the Equilibrium Constant (and Temperature's Effect) with Beer's Law (S07343)
  • Micro-Scale Electrochemical Cells – Voltaic and Electrolytic (S07344)
